The Republic of Belarus

 

On geographical maps our republic looks like a birch leaf in outline. The area of Belarus is 207,6 thousand square km, it stretches 560 km from north to south and 650 km from west to east.

It borders on the Polish republic, on Russia and the Ukraine, on Baltic republics.

Nearly 12 million people live in the multinational Belarus. The Republic is divided into 6 regions: Brest, Gomel, Grodno, Minsk, Mogilev and Vitebsk and 117 districts. There are 100 cities and towns, 110 townships and about 25,000 villages. 64 % of the population live in the towns.

Most of Belarus is a flat country. More than a quarter of the republic’s area is covered with forests and bushes. The climate in our republic is moderately continental, so the weather is unstable here. There are over 20,000 long and short rivers and more than 10,000 lakes in Belarus.

Our republic is an independent state. It has its own national Emblem, Anthem, Flag and Government. Belarus is the member of the United Nations Organization.

SURPRISE PARTY

 

Liz was just finishing the final details for the surprise party she was planning for her husband. She had been thoroughly preparing for this event, designing every aspect of the party from the invitations to the food, and she was very excited about it. Family members whom Andrew hadn't seen in years were flying in from Poland in a few days. Liz had tracked down several college friends, and they were coming from various places across the country. A band and dancers were invited.

The best part for Liz was that she knew Andrew did not have any idea about the party. She could not wait to see the look on his face when he walked into a big "Surprise!" in his own home.

The party was supposed to be on Saturday. As Liz was daydreaming about picking relatives up at the airport the next day and taking them to their hotel, Andrew walked into the kitchen and said, quite certainly, "Sweetheart, I don't want anything special done for my birthday." "What do you mean?" Liz responded calmly, though her heart began to beat. "I mean that I don't want a surprise party." "Okay," Liz said. "Not a problem." Liz's mind raced. There was nothing she could do about Andrew's request now. And, frankly, she didn't want to. Liz had been planning this for more than a year. The party would go off as she intended. She did not want all of her effort to fail. When Andrew came home Saturday evening from playing soccer with friends, he was shocked. Tears filled his eyes. This response was something Liz had not predicted. Among the crowd he saw friends whom he had not seen in nearly 20 years and family members who had come from Poland just for this evening. But along with being deeply moved, he was also angry with his wife. He knew he could be emotional, and he did not like people to see him that way. That was why he did not like being surprised.

Salsa music filled the home of Liz and Andrew. Liz whispered "I love you" in Andrew's ear, they shared a kiss, and the two danced the whole night.

Speaker 1: I am a shop assistant and I work in a shop and what really makes me angry is when I am serving somebody and then their mobiles ring and they answer the phone and start having a conversation. It is really annoying. I think if you are in a shop and talking to a shop assistant, you shouldn’t answer the phone.

Speaker 2: I hate when people talk very loudly on their mobile phones in public places. The other day I was in the waiting room at the doctor’s and there was a man whose mobile rang about every ten minutes and we all had to listen to him talking loudly to his wife, then to his boss, then to a garage mechanic… I think if you are in a public place, you should speak really quietly or go somewhere else. And you don’t have to shout – the other people can hear you perfectly well.

Speaker 3: What really annoys me is people who use their phones a lot when they are with other people – like you are out having a meal with someone and they spend the whole time talking on the phone or texting messages to other people to arrange what they are doing the next day. I think it is very rude.
